Discord is a free text and voice chat medium. The application can be used from within the web browser or downloaded, with the link for both being on the homepage of its website: https://discordapp.com. It is available for several operating systems, and can be accessed via a web-app on certain browsers, which can be seen in the table below.

Supported Operating Systems

Operating system Versions
Windows Windows 7 SP1&2, Windows 8, Windows 8.1, Windows 10
macOS OS X 10.10 Yosemite, OS X 10.11 El Capitan, macOS 10.12 Sierra
Android Android 4.1 (Jellybean), Android 4.4/4.5 (KitKat), Android 5.0/5.1 (Lollipop), Android 6.0 (Marshmallow), Android 7.0/7.1 (Nougat)
iOS iOS 8.1, iOS 9, iOS 10, iOS 11
Linux OS Arch Linux, Debian, Fedora, Gentoo, OpenEmbedded/Yocto, openSUSE, OpenWrt, Ubuntu
